The Obershaw House

Community Action Partnership operates the Obershaw Transitional Housing Program. This is a 12-month case management program available through Referral ONLY! The Obershaw Program is designed to assist low-income homeless families in becoming self-sufficient and obtaining permanent housing.

Requirements to reside at the Obershaw House

  • Client must be REFERRED to the Program by an organization that is assisting them to obtain housing.
  • Client must be homeless.
  • Client must meet income-guidelines.
  • Client must agree to case management and comply with an established case management plan.
  • Client MUST obtain employment within 30 days of entering program.
  • Program has a ZERO Tolerance for drugs/alcohol/violence.

Obershaw House Resident Spotlight

When Angel and her two children came to the Obershaw House, they were homeless and residing in a motel. While in the Obershaw House, Angel has overcome many barriers and accomplished many things. She obtained a second job, purchased a better car and worked on self-esteem issues. The family graduated from this program in 2008 and has moved into permanent housing.
